ABOUT STEVE REED
British Labour and Co-operative Party politician who began serving as a Member of Parliament for Croydon North in 2012. He was named one of the most influential council leaders in Britain by the Local Government Chronicle in 2011.
He studied English at Sheffield University.
During his time as leader of the Lambeth Council, the Lambeth borough went from having a one star ranking by the Audit Commission in 2006 to having a three-star ranking by 2009.
His family worked at Odhams printing factory in Watford.
He was appointed a Shadow Home Office Minister by Labour Leader Ed Miliband in October 2013.
